Pablo Creek

Ponte Vedra Beach, FL 32082
Pablo Creek Pablo Creek is one of the popular Local Business located in ,Ponte Vedra Beach listed under Golf Course in Ponte Vedra Beach , Local business in Ponte Vedra Beach ,

Contact Details & Working Hours

Map of Pablo Creek